Understanding the Mechanics of Crash Gaming

The core principle of crash games is deceptively simple. A multiplier begins at 1x and gradually increases over time. Players place their initial bet before the round begins. The longer the round continues without crashing, the higher the multiplier climbs, and consequently, the greater the potential return on investment. However, at any random point, the multiplier will ‘crash,’ resulting in a loss of the initial bet. The key is to ‘cash out’ before the crash occurs, securing a profit based on the current multiplier. This dynamic creates a unique blend of excitement and anxiety, as players are constantly weighing the potential rewards against the escalating risk. It is a game of probability and, importantly, discipline. Many newcomers are drawn in by the possibility of large wins, but quickly learn that consistent profits require a methodical approach.

The Role of the Random Number Generator (RNG)

Central to the fairness and unpredictability of crash games is the Random Number Generator (RNG). The RNG is a sophisticated algorithm designed to produce truly random outcomes, ensuring that the timing of the crash is entirely unpredictable. Reputable platforms, like those reviewed on various gaming sites, utilize certified RNGs that are regularly audited by independent testing agencies. These audits verify the integrity of the RNG and confirm that it is functioning correctly, generating unbiased results. Players should always seek out platforms that prioritize transparency and utilize provably fair systems, which allow players to independently verify the randomness of each game round. Understanding the role of the RNG is key to appreciating the inherent fairness – or unfairness, if a rogue site is used – of the game.

Risk Management and Bankroll Control

Effective risk management and bankroll control are the cornerstones of successful crash gaming. Never bet more than you can afford to lose. A common rule of thumb is to allocate only a small percentage of your overall bankroll to each bet – typically between 1% and 5%. This minimizes the impact of potential losses and allows you to weather losing streaks. Furthermore, it’s crucial to avoid chasing losses. Resisting the urge to double down or increase your bets in an attempt to recover lost funds is essential. Instead, stick to your pre-defined strategy and bankroll management plan. Responsible gambling is paramount; set limits on your playtime and spending, and never gamble under the influence of alcohol or drugs.

Evaluating Security and Fairness Features

Beyond licensing and regulation, several specific features indicate a platform’s commitment to security and fairness. Two-factor authentication (2FA) adds an extra layer of security to your account, requiring a code from your mobile device in addition to your password. SSL encryption safeguards your data during transmission, preventing unauthorized access. Provably fair systems, leveraging cryptographic algorithms, allow players to verify the integrity of each game round, ensuring that the outcomes are genuinely random. Transparent terms and conditions, clearly outlining the rules of the game and the platform's policies, are also a sign of a reputable operator. Additionally, responsive customer support, available through multiple channels (live chat, email, phone), is essential for addressing any concerns or issues you may encounter.
